This tour offers visitors the opportunity to explore Ground Zero and the 9/11 Memorial, guided by a New Yorker with personal connections to the events. Through their stories, you will gain a deeper understanding of the tragedy and heroism that occurred on September 11th.

The tour starts at St. Paul’s Chapel, the oldest public building in NYC, which played a crucial role as a makeshift rescue center during 9/11. Other highlights include visiting the Firefighters 9/11 Memorial Wall, Engine and Ladder Company 10/10, and paying respects at the 9/11 Memorial and Reflecting Absence Memorial.

At the end of the tour, optional timed admission tickets are provided for the One World Observatory, where visitors can experience the marvel of engineering and architecture at the One World Trade Center.

One World Observatory

NYC: 9/11 Memorial Tour and Optional Observatory Ticket - One World Observatory

Located at Ground Zero, the One World Observatory offers a breathtaking experience with panoramic views of the New York skyline.

Marvel at the architectural masterpiece of the One World Trade Center, a symbol of resilience and hope.

Feel a sense of awe as you step into the Sky Pod elevator and ascend 1,250 feet in just 60 seconds.

Enjoy the captivating displays and interactive touch screen videos that provide insight into the history of the World Trade Towers and the construction of the new One World Trade Center.

Indulge in dining options on the observation deck while taking in the stunning vistas of the city below.
